Output 70375381bbddcbe7161a568333a973dcb0385cb56a1bc50ffcfda15c7956913d:0

value
3664682
script pubkey
OP_0 OP_PUSHBYTES_20 ff29965e50aa0b3de2ae078cfbeabc6fd27806a7
address
bc1qlu5evhjs4g9nmc4wq7x0h64udlf8sp48p3wkgm
transaction
70375381bbddcbe7161a568333a973dcb0385cb56a1bc50ffcfda15c7956913d
spent
true